ProxyPassReverse is used for rewriting response headers related only to 
redirection.   As per the docs, it affects only “Location”, “Content-Location” 
and “URI” headers on HTTP redirect responses.

The example they give is helpful (although cluttered with other concepts).  
Here is a more crystalized version of the example and a protocol exchange for 
clarity.


ProxyPass         "/mirror/foo/" "http://backend.example.com/";
ProxyPassReverse  "/mirror/foo/" "http://backend.example.com/";
If the backend server uses a redirect to some other location on the same 
backend server, the reverse-proxy rewrites the ‘redirect headers’ according to 
the ProxyPassReverse directive.

Let’s say the backend.example.com uses the location 
header<https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/HTTP_location> to redirect a request 
http://backend.example.com/bar to http://backend.example.com/quux.  The 
end-to-end protocol exchange looks something like (caveat: written without 
validating):

Client Request:

GET /mirror/foo/bar HTTP/1.1

Host: example.com



Reverse Proxy rewrites it to the backend (courtesy of the ProxyPass directive):

GET /bar HTTP/1.1

Host: backend.example.com



Backend Server responds with a redirect using the location 
header<https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/HTTP_location>:

HTTP/1.1 302 Found

Location: http://backend.example.com/quux

Reverse Proxy Intervenes (courtesy of the ProxyPassReverse directive) and 
rewrites the Location header to be:

HTTP/1.1 302 Found

Location: http://example.com/mirror/foo/quux

The client then reissues the request to the Location 
http://example.com/mirror/foo/quux and the Reverse Proxy forwards it onto 
http://backend.example.com/quux.
